Latest Patents
Cory's latest patents include a pioneering system for establishing event rules for sales management databases. This system monitors information stored in corporate databases to determine when certain business-related events occur. The event information is transmitted over the Internet to a print production facility, which automatically generates print requisitions or print production orders based on those events. Moreover, it allows for the possibility of routing print requisitions through an existing procurement system before generating orders. Additionally, Cory’s related patent outlines a methodology for using a sales management system to facilitate the generation of printed products, employing similar principles of event monitoring and automation.
